
June 12, 2025 – Shares of Trident Digital Tech Holdings (TDTH) nosedived nearly 40% in early Thursday trading, falling from around $0.45 in premarket hours to under $0.20, after the company revealed an ambitious $500 million financing initiative to create a corporate XRP Treasury.
The Singapore-based firm says it plans to acquire a substantial amount of XRP tokens as part of its long-term reserves strategy. According to the announcement, the tokens will be used in staking protocols to generate yield and to deepen the company’s involvement in the Ripple ecosystem.
Strategic Shift Met with Investor Skepticism
Despite positioning the move as a bold step into blockchain-native corporate finance, investor reaction was sharply negative. The company’s stock plummeted within hours of the announcement, erasing a significant portion of its market capitalization.
Trident’s proposed initiative will be funded through a mix of equity issuance, structured financing, and strategic placements. The firm also appointed Chaince Securities LLC as its strategic advisor to guide the project.
CEO Soon Huat Lim defended the initiative, stating:
“We see digital assets as key enablers in the evolution of the global financial landscape. This initiative reflects our belief in the transformative potential of blockchain technology.”
However, the market didn’t seem to share Lim’s optimism. The steep sell-off suggests that investors are wary of the risks tied to such a sizable commitment to a single digital asset especially one like XRP, which has faced its own regulatory and market volatility over the years.
XRP Treasury Rollout Expected in Late 2025
According to Trident, the XRP Treasury is expected to launch in H2 2025, pending regulatory approvals and broader market conditions. Discussions are reportedly underway with crypto foundations and institutional partners to negotiate favorable terms for acquiring XRP and developing related infrastructure.
While the move could potentially mark a significant evolution in corporate finance blending traditional treasury management with blockchain strategy it’s clear that shareholders were caught off guard by the magnitude and risk profile of the plan.
